linux根据关键词查询进程的命令

不及物动词 其他 53

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,我们可以使用一些命令来根据关键词查询进程。以下是两个常用的命令:pgrep和ps。

    1. pgrep命令:pgrep命令可以根据进程名或者其他选择条件查询进程。它会返回与关键词匹配的进程ID。

    例如,要查询所有包含关键词”apache”的进程,可以使用以下命令:
    pgrep apache

    如果要查询包含关键词”apache”且属于root用户的进程,可以使用以下命令:
    pgrep -u root apache

    2. ps命令:ps命令用于报告进程状态。它可以显示当前系统中运行的所有进程的详细信息。

    例如,要查询所有包含关键词”apache”的进程,可以使用以下命令:
    ps -ef | grep apache

    如果要查询包含关键词”apache”且属于root用户的进程,可以使用以下命令:
    ps -ef | grep apache | grep root

    以上就是在Linux系统中根据关键词查询进程的两个常用命令。通过使用这些命令,我们可以方便地定位和管理系统中的进程。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,有几种命令可以根据关键词查询进程。下面列出了五种常用的命令:

    1. ps命令:
    使用ps命令可以列出当前系统上运行的进程。可以使用grep命令结合ps命令来根据关键词过滤进程。
    例如:ps aux | grep 关键词

    2. pgrep命令:
    pgrep命令可以根据进程的名称或者其他属性来查询进程。它会返回与关键词匹配的进程的PID(进程ID)。
    例如:pgrep -l 关键词

    3. top命令:
    top命令可以实时显示正在运行的进程,并根据CPU和内存使用情况对其进行排序。可以使用top命令的搜索功能来过滤进程。
    例如:按下’/’键,然后输入关键词

    4. htop命令:
    htop是一个交互式的进程查看器,类似于top命令,但提供了更多的功能和选项。可以使用htop命令进行进程过滤。
    例如:按下’F4’键,然后输入关键词

    5. pstree命令:
    pstree命令以树状结构显示进程和它们之间的关系。可以使用grep命令结合pstree命令来过滤进程。
    例如:pstree | grep 关键词

    通过以上几种命令,可以根据关键词查询进程,并对结果进行过滤和排序。根据实际需求选择合适的命令来查询进程信息。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,可以使用一些命令来根据关键词查询进程。下面是几种常见的方法:

    1. 使用ps命令配合grep命令查询进程:
    “`
    ps aux | grep keyword
    “`
    这个命令将会列出包含关键词的所有进程。其中,”ps aux”用于显示所有的进程信息,”grep keyword”用于过滤出包含关键词的行。

    2. 使用pgrep命令查询进程ID:
    “`
    pgrep keyword
    “`
    这个命令将会输出包含关键词的所有进程的进程ID。

    3. 使用htop命令交互式地查询进程:
    “`
    htop
    “`
    这个命令会打开一个交互式的进程查看器。在htop界面中,可以使用关键词过滤来查找匹配的进程。按下”F4″键,然后输入关键词,即可只显示匹配的进程。

    4. 使用top命令查看进程并进行排序:
    “`
    top -c -n 1 | grep keyword
    “`
    这个命令将会显示匹配关键词的进程,并按需求进行排序。其中,”-c”选项将会显示完整的命令行信息,”-n 1″选项表示只显示一次。

    以上是一些常见的查询进程的方法。根据实际需求,可以选择合适的方法来查找特定的进程。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部